You cannot check the training hours for Subject 2 online; they are only visible on the training hour recording machines at the driving school. Below are the precautions for recording training hours for the driving license test: 1. Maximum of four hours per day: Theoretical training is limited to a maximum of 4 hours per day; if the study time exceeds 4 hours, it will be counted as 4 hours. 2. Avoid prolonged inactivity: To ensure students are actively learning, if no operation is performed within 5 minutes, the system will automatically log out and stop timing. 3. Proper logout: After completing the training, please click the "Exit" button in the lower left corner of the pop-up window. Do not close the pop-up window directly, otherwise, your account may be locked for 10 minutes, preventing login.

The way I usually check my driving test study hours on my phone is quite convenient. For example, with the 'Driving Test Guide' app I use, after registering and logging in, I just go to the personal center and click on 'Learning Records' to see the accumulated time for theory classes and driving practice. The system automatically tracks video learning duration and updates the data after each session. I remember during the initial learning phase, I was always worried about falling behind, so I made it a habit to check my phone before bed. If I encountered display errors, such as the study hours not updating, I would usually restart the app or check the network connection; if that didn't work, I'd contact the driving school instructor for backend assistance. When downloading the app, make sure it's the latest version, otherwise it might lag and affect functionality. Checking study hours on my phone saves a lot of time running to the driving school and also reminds me to make up for any missed hours to avoid issues with the exam, which is especially suitable for someone like me who loves using tech tools.

What grade of gasoline should an Audi Q7 use?

Audi Q7 is a mid-to-large-sized SUV. It is recommended to use 95-octane gasoline (formerly 97-octane) for Audi Q7. In China, it is advisable to use gasoline with an octane rating of 95 or higher, which is more beneficial for the vehicle's future maintenance. Here are some relevant details: 1. The quality of the gasoline and whether it is used correctly will directly affect the lifespan of the car. Long-term use of gasoline with a lower octane rating than required by the vehicle is equivalent to using substandard gasoline, which can be considered a car killer. Due to not meeting the vehicle's compression ratio requirements, incomplete combustion of gasoline can lead to increased engine knocking, reduced power, increased fuel consumption, and more carbon deposits in the cylinders and valves.

What is the function of engine oil in a car?

Functions of automotive engine oil: 1. As a lubricant: It reduces friction and wear between moving parts, such as between cylinder liners and piston rings, or camshafts. 2. As a coolant: It absorbs heat generated in the combustion chamber and piston crowns, cooling the engine and preventing overheating. 3. As a sealant: It fills the gaps between piston rings and cylinder liners to prevent pressure leakage. 4. As a cleaner: It prevents contaminants and oxide impurities from combustion from adhering to the engine internals, maintaining cleanliness. 5. As a rust inhibitor: It neutralizes acidic substances produced by combustion gases, preventing rust and corrosion in the engine.

What happens when a car battery is low on power?

When a car battery is low on power, the following symptoms may occur: 1. Some vehicle models will display a battery warning light on the dashboard. 2. Most batteries also have an inspection hole. If the inspection hole is green, it indicates the battery is in good condition with no issues. If the inspection hole is black, it means the battery is severely depleted and needs charging. If the inspection hole is white, it indicates the battery is already damaged. 3. If the car has difficulty starting, takes longer than usual to start, fails to start after multiple attempts, or cannot start when cold, these are signs of a low battery. 4. If the vehicle fails to start, sometimes you may hear the starter solenoid making a "clicking" sound, or there may be no response at all, which strongly suggests insufficient battery power. 5. In severe cases, the headlights may dim or the horn sound may become weaker. 6. When turning on the ignition, the vehicle's electrical devices such as the dashboard and central display may experience delays.

What Causes Water in Diesel Engine Oil?

Diesel engine oil mixing with water can be caused by the following reasons: 1. Cylinder liner damage: When cracks appear in the cylinder liner, coolant can seep directly into the engine oil pan through the cylinder wall. 2. Engine water plug leakage: If the engine water plug is severely aged, it will inevitably leak, allowing coolant to mix directly into the oil pan. 3. Radiator damage: A broken radiator hose can also lead to water entering the engine oil. Below is relevant information about engine oil: Engine oil, also known as motor oil or engine lubricant, is a substance enhanced with additives in base oil. It mainly contains anti-wear additives, detergents, dispersants, and multi-grade oil viscosity index improvers. Engine oil is used for lubricating internal combustion engines.
